Subaru says that anything more than a 1/4" difference in circumference is an issue. Less than that and it shouldn't matter.

Ask me what the difference in tread depth translates to. I have no idea.

Originally Posted by Unit 91
Subaru says that anything more than a 1/4" difference in circumference is an issue. Less than that and it shouldn't matter.

Ask me what the difference in tread depth translates to. I have no idea.
Well, if the measurement of .04mm for the tread depth difference is accurate, it would translate into a .25mm difference in rolling circumference... which would be negligible.

circumference = pi * diameter
diameter being .08, or 2 * radius (which is .04)

I'm not a math geek and wouldn't normally know this, but the topic was rehashed on the Forester boards recently.
